Documentation
¶
Index ¶
- Constants
- type DigitalOceanProvider
- func (p *DigitalOceanProvider) DeleteWorkstation(params *cloud.WorkstationDeleteParams) error
- func (p *DigitalOceanProvider) GetStatus() (*cloud.WorkstationStatus, error)
- func (p *DigitalOceanProvider) StartWorkstation(params *cloud.WorkstationStartParams) error
- func (p *DigitalOceanProvider) StopWorkstation(params *cloud.WorkstationStopParams) error
Constants ¶
View Source
const MIN_WORKSTATION_AGE_MINUTES = 3
Variables ¶
This section is empty.
Functions ¶
This section is empty.
Types ¶
type DigitalOceanProvider ¶
type DigitalOceanProvider struct {
// contains filtered or unexported fields
}
func NewDigitalOceanProvider ¶
func NewDigitalOceanProvider() *DigitalOceanProvider
func (*DigitalOceanProvider) DeleteWorkstation ¶
func (p *DigitalOceanProvider) DeleteWorkstation(params *cloud.WorkstationDeleteParams) error
func (*DigitalOceanProvider) GetStatus ¶
func (p *DigitalOceanProvider) GetStatus() (*cloud.WorkstationStatus, error)
func (*DigitalOceanProvider) StartWorkstation ¶
func (p *DigitalOceanProvider) StartWorkstation(params *cloud.WorkstationStartParams) error
func (*DigitalOceanProvider) StopWorkstation ¶
func (p *DigitalOceanProvider) StopWorkstation(params *cloud.WorkstationStopParams) error
Click to show internal directories.
Click to hide internal directories.